Nice work on the Chirplet waveform preview, Dovren. One thing for the support folks reading this: the preview downsamples peaks client-side, so very quiet recordings can look flat even when audio is present. That's expected, not a bug — please check playback before filing. Also note the render cancels if the file exceeds the duration cap, which will show as an empty strip. If customers report blank previews, compare their file against the thresholds defined here.

tuning constants:
QUOTAS = {
    "druwyn": 5,
    "holix": 5,
    "zorath": 5,
    "holwyn": 10,
}

Ticket: Vault locked — inventory reconciliation blocked

The Copperbin reconciliation job failed at 02:10 because the Stilwater secrets vault auto-sealed after a node restart. Nightly stock counts for the Fenhall warehouse are stale until unseal. Release manager must not ship build 412 before the job reruns clean. Unseal via the recovery console using the passphrase on the following line.

unlock words, yadup-yagef: zorael-druix

Vendor note: our snapshot testing for UI components runs through Snapframe, licensed via Quillard Systems. New team members should not modify baseline images without approval from the design lead. Contract renewals happen each April. For licensing questions or access requests, contact the vendor account manager at the address below.

pager mailbox: sormir@qirvanworks.corp